JAW 29 1 <br />TO: Board of C unt Commissioners <br />FROM: Doug Wright, Director <br />Department of Emergency Services <br />DATE: January 22, 1991 <br />SUBJECT: Approval of Renewal of UPS Contract with <br />EPE Technologies, Inc., for E911 Center <br />It is respectfully requested that the information contained herein <br />be given formal consideration by the Board of County Commissioners <br />at the next scheduled meeting. <br />DESCRIPTION AND CONDITIONS: <br />The service agreement with EPE Technologies for scheduled and <br />remedial maintenance for the uninterrupted power supply (UPS) <br />equipment at the E911 Communications Center is due for renewal at <br />this time. The company has fulfilled contract commitments over the <br />past year and service has been very satisfactory. No failure of <br />the equipment has been experienced over the past year and staff <br />feels this is largely due to the preventative maintenance program <br />provided in -the contract. _ <br />Funding for renewal of the contract" was budgeted in this fiscal <br />year in the amount of $6,500. The contract forwarded to the county <br />this fiscal year reflects a price'of $4,950 or a reduction of <br />$1,050. <br />The company is currently offering a spare parts kit for our OPS <br />system that can be purchased over a three year period. The spare <br />parts kit is available for $4,500 which can be paid in three annual <br />installments of $1,500 per year. Staff recommends purchase of the <br />spare parts kit to reduce down time of the E911 system due to UPS <br />failure. <br />ALTERNATIVES AND ANALYSIS: <br />Purchase of the spare parts kit would be beneficial to the county <br />in that needed repairs on the UPS system could be completed on site <br />quickly without have to wait for parts to be flown in from one of <br />the company parts depots.. <br />If the Board deems it appropriate to purchase the spare parts kit, <br />EPE Technologies, Inc., agrees to guarantee the cost of the annual <br />service contract at the $4,950 level for the three year period. '- <br />The recommendation to purchase the spare parts kit is also <br />predicated on the fact that our system is aging and as it gets <br />older, the spare=parts being immediately available will preclude <br />any extended delay in getting this very necessary system back on <br />line. <br />RECOMMENDATION: <br />Staff recommends'the Board of County Commissioners approve renewal <br />Of the EPE Maintenance Agreement in the amount of $4,950 and <br />authorize the purchase of the spare parts kit for $4,500 payable in <br />three annual installments of $1,500. Total funds required for the <br />maintenance contract and first annual payment for the spare parts <br />kit this fiscal year would be $6,450, which is less than the $6?500 <br />budgeted. <br />Staff also recommends that the Board authorize the Chairman to <br />execute the necessary documents to formalize the agreement. <br />22 <br />
